Three reasons we don’t want a Golovkin/Alvarez trilogy

1. GGG has to knock Canelo out to win

In a summary of the first two reasons this reason is the most important reason it wouldn’t be wise to have a trilogy and it is mainly in the perspective of GGG he has to knockout Canelo to win. I personally don’t even think a knockdown would be enough to beat Canelo because of his cash cow status. GGG is 36 years of age and if they fought again he will 37 years of age. He didn’t show signs of aging Canelo is just younger and has a hell of a chin. During the fight GGG dazed Canelo a few times, but couldn’t finish the job in the first two fights it would be even tougher to do that in a trilogy. So, GGG is fighting an uphill battle he is fighting Canelo and the judges and he gets a KO.
